Yoshinoya shortens second‑wave Dragon Quest Walk set sales period to one week

Yoshinoya announced that the second wave of its collaboration with the mobile game Dragon Quest Walk will be on sale for only one week. The "Dragon Quest Walk Set" – which includes an original figurine – was originally scheduled to run from July 16 10:00 to July 29 20:00, but the end date has been moved up to July 22 24:00. As with the first wave, daily sales are capped and stores will stop selling once the day's quota is reached, resuming at 10:00 the following day.

The first‑wave set sold out quickly, prompting the company to adjust the schedule for the second wave. Fans reacted with a mix of disappointment over the shortened period, concern that the limited supply could fuel resale, and frustration at having to race to purchase during weekday hours. Some commenters welcomed the flexible response and expressed support for Yoshinoya’s continued collaboration with the game.
